Lifespan and operational life in Thalassery
The longevity of an energy storage system is a critical factor for any investment in Thalassery, directly impacting the long-term value and replacement cycles. The operational life of a battery is often measured in charge-discharge cycles, which vary significantly between lithium and lead-acid technologies, especially when subjected to the frequent power fluctuations common in KSEBL-served areas.
- Lithium: Typically offers an operational life exceeding 10 years, often reaching 2,000 to 6,000 cycles or more. This extended lifespan translates to fewer replacements and a lower total cost of ownership over time for Thalassery users.
- Lead-acid: Generally provides 3 to 5 years of operational life, or around 500-1000 cycles. This shorter lifespan means more frequent replacements, which can add to the long-term expense and inconvenience for properties in Thalassery.
Maintenance: sealed vs water-topping
Maintenance requirements directly influence the convenience and ongoing effort associated with your power backup system. In a dynamic city like Thalassery, a low-maintenance solution is often preferred, allowing property owners to focus on their daily activities without constant battery checks. The design differences between lithium and lead-acid batteries play a significant role here.
- Lithium: Designed as a sealed, maintenance-free unit. There is no need for water-topping, acid level checks, or terminal cleaning. This 'set-and-forget' convenience is a major advantage for busy households and businesses in Thalassery.
- Lead-acid: Requires periodic maintenance, including checking electrolyte levels and topping up with distilled water every few months. This can be a chore, especially in hard-to-reach installations, and neglecting it can reduce battery lifespan and performance in Thalassery's warm-humid climate.

Charge speed, depth of discharge, and reliability under Warm-Humid conditions
Performance metrics like charging speed and usable capacity (depth of discharge) are vital for ensuring continuous power, especially during frequent or extended outages in Thalassery. The ability of a battery to perform reliably in a Warm-Humid climate, like that of Thalassery, also differentiates the technologies. PuREPower systems are engineered for Indian conditions, excelling in these areas.
- Lithium: Offers rapid charging capabilities, allowing the battery to replenish energy much faster after an outage. It can safely discharge to 80-90% or even 100% of its capacity without significant degradation, providing more usable energy. Their sealed design and robust thermal management ensure consistent performance in Warm-Humid conditions.
- Lead-acid: Charges at a slower rate, meaning longer recovery times after a power cut. To preserve its lifespan, it's generally recommended not to discharge lead-acid batteries beyond 50% of their capacity, effectively halving their usable energy. Performance can also be more susceptible to temperature fluctuations and humidity.
Safety and environmental considerations for Thalassery
When choosing an energy storage solution for your Thalassery property, safety and environmental impact are increasingly important considerations. Modern lithium-integrated systems are designed with advanced safety features and a focus on responsible end-of-life management, offering a cleaner, more secure option. This aligns with the High (2000-3000 mm/yr) monsoon intensity, requiring sealed and robust solutions.
- Lithium: Integrated systems like PuREPower feature sophisticated Battery Management Systems (BMS) for enhanced safety, preventing overcharge, over-discharge, and overheating. Their sealed, corrosion-resistant build is ideal for Thalassery's coastal proximity and high monsoon intensity, preventing acid leaks. They also have a lower environmental impact over their long lifespan.
- Lead-acid: Contains corrosive sulfuric acid, which can pose a risk of leaks if the battery casing is damaged. While recyclable, the disposal process requires careful handling due to lead content. The unsealed nature of some lead-acid batteries can also lead to gas emissions during charging.
